Approximately 70% of table salt sold in the United States is fortified with iodine to help prevent nutrient deficiencies. This common seasoning, typically referred to as table salt, is chemically known as sodium chloride (NaCl). However, the term 'salt' encompasses a vast category of chemical compounds, making it important to understand what makes table salt unique.
